If you’re like me, Pizza Day in the middle school cafeteria was just a cruel reminder that you had a brown bagged lunch waiting in your locker. There would be no fish sticks, no chicken patties, no chocolate milk. Instead, you would dive deep into depths of culinary hell with whatever your parents deemed edible the night before.
Here are the Top 10 Trashiest Brown Bag Lunches.
10. Anything in a Plastic Grocery Bag
Let’s kick this off by breaking the mold immediately.
If you showed up to school with lunch in a blue or white grocery bag, THAT. IS. TRASH.
Literally. Your lunch is basically in a trash bag.
9. Bargain Brand Snacks
If you showed up to the lunch table with a bag of Clancy potato chips from Aldi, or God help you, Great Value pretzels, you’re probably washing it down with a “cola” like substance.
You definitely heard the phrase, “It tastes just like the name brand” growing up. Spoiler alert, it does not.
8. Canned Beverage
This may be controversial but the cafeteria is no place for a can of anything.
Nothing alerts your classmates more to your trash status than popping the tab on a can of Mellow Yellow right before you tuck into a bologna sandwich.

7. The Random Pairing
As adults we can relate to the idea of throwing two eggs, a slice of pizza, and leftover spinach dip on a plate and calling it lunch.
But if we’re talking about the formative years of a pre-pubescent middle schooler, let’s keep the experimentation to chemistry. This screams, my parents forgot I was here until this morning lunch is whatever was in the front of the fridge.
6. Cold Leftovers
Time is a great teacher.
The thought of eating cold leftovers is not uncommon to me. It’s welcomed at this point. I’m eating cold leftovers as I type this.
But being the kid that’s showing up to the lunch room with a Tupperware container of last night’s rigatoni, that’s been warming to a temperature the board of health would call, “problematic,” is straight trash.
5. Fast Food
We’ve officially turned the corner and are galloping into our final lap. At number 5 we have the fast food brown bagged lunch.
If you’re pulling a quarter pounder out of your backpack you also missed the bus, had to wake your Mum up even though she’s on night shift, and she hit the Mickey D’s 2 minutes from school before she dropped you off.
Home cooking at its finest.
4. All Snacks
How can you tell someone doesn’t respect their Step-dad? When they dump out their lunch and it’s all snacks.
Doritos with a side of Little Debbies, two Kit-Kats, and some Gushers as a palette cleanser.
This food pyramid wasn’t built by the aliens but by a kid who calls his Mom’s husband, Scott.
3. Same Lunch, Different Day
Kicking off the top 3 is the Same Lunch Different Day.
If variety is the spice of life, I’m oatmeal. Actually oatmeal would be a welcomed treat to the monotony of; salami and cheese, pack of cookies, bag of chips, Capri Sun.
This method of lunch packing usually aligns with buying in bulk and whatever’s on sale. “I’m not buying Maple Turkey at $6.99 a pound!” Ok Dad, we’re at the movies right now and people are scared.
2. Heels Only Sandwich
Nothing says mom and dad forgot to hit the grocery store more than a peanut butter sandwich made with two heels.
This break glass in case of emergency lunch is usually accompanied by an apple 3 days past its prime and some adult authority figure saying, “just eat around the brown part. That won’t kill you.”
1. The Forgotten Lunch
Coming in at number 1, the king of the trashiest brown bag lunches is…no lunch at all!
That’s right folks. The trashiest thing you can pack for lunch is an excuse. I left it on the table. I was running late. Are you going to eat that?
This now puts you in the position to barter and trade with your classmates for whatever unwanted items they have. Do you like carrot sticks, a can of fruit cocktail, and Fig Newtons? No? Neither do they. So get ready to tuck in to your MacGyvered lunch.
